Setting up the Mac terminal emulator. Move down to the 'Document transfer port and format' item and select Serial/ASCII (use the sideways arrows to change). Press Stop repeatedly to arrive at the initial page.Its still a useful utility for those systems that only offer dialup connections and for connecting to devices through a serial port, like many routers.Serial Terminal Basics a learn.sparkfun.com tutorialYou can start the Initial Setup dialog when you connect a terminal, PC or workstation running a terminal emulation program to the serial port on the managed. In its day, many people used it to connect to Bulletin Board Systems and download files. Your terminal emulator is expecting to see the data on your COM1 port but youre actually.Serial Terminal Basics - learn.sparkfun.comZTerm is a terminal emulation program for the Macintosh. In the Settings menu select Terminal Is a serial cable connected between a PC and a serial port.
Terminal Emulator Serial Port Mac Terminal EmulatorOnce you have learned the ins and outs of a terminal application, it can be a very powerful tool in your electronics and programming arsenal. They allow you to see data sent to and from your microcontroller, and that data can be used for a number of reasons including troubleshooting/debugging, communication testing, calibrating sensors, configuring modules, and data monitoring. This tutorial is here to help you understand what these terms mean and how they form the larger picture that is serial communication over a terminal.In short, serial terminal programs make working with microcontrollers that much simpler. For someone who isn't familiar with these terms and the context in which they are used, they can be confusing at times. These are all words that get thrown around a lot when working with electronics, especially microcontrollers. ![]() When discussing terminal emulators, it's these terminal of days past that are being referenced.Today, terminal programs are "emulating" the experience that was working on one of these terminals. Terminals that could display text only were referred to as text terminals, and later came graphical terminals. Many consisted of a keyboard and a screen. These terminals came in many form factors, but they soon began to resemble what would become their personal computer descendants. Punch cards and paper tape reels where one such interface, but there was also what was known as a terminal that was used for entering and retrieving data. And, often, when reading other tutorials and hookup guides, you will be requested to open a terminal window. Many terminals use to emulate specific types of computer terminals, but today, most terminals are more generic in their interface.When working on a modern operating system, the word terminal window will often be used to describe working within one of these applications. For the purposes of this tutorial, just the word terminal will be used. Libdvdcss mac downloadHence the confusion when using that word. In Mac OS, the command prompt is even called Terminal. Terminal vs Command LineA terminal is not a command prompt, though the two are somewhat similar. However, this tutorial will not cover these features. Many have network communication capabilities such as telnet and SSH. It highly recommended that you read that page as well to get the full picture.ASCII - Short for the American Standard Code for Information Interchange's character encoding scheme, ASCII encodes special characters from our keyboards and converts them to 7-bit binary integers that can be recognized by a number of programs and devices. Many of these terms are covered in a lot more detail in our Serial Communication tutorial. Basic TerminologyHere are some terms you should be familiar with when working within a serial terminal window. For now, just know how to distinguish between the two. We will go over how to create a serial terminal connection within a command line interface later in this tutorial. Android terminal emulator mac addressThis should be hooked up to the TX line of the device with which you would like to communicate.COM Port (Serial Port) - Each device you connect to your computer will be assigned a specific port number. The RX line on any device is there to receive data. This should be hooked up to the RX line of the device with which you would like to communicate.Receive (RX) - Also known as Data In or RXI. The TX line on any device is there to transmit data. Just remember that all the links in your chain of communication have to be "speaking" at the same speed, otherwise data will be misinterpreted on one end or the other.Transmit (TX) - Also known as Data Out or TXO. 9600 is the standard rate, but other speeds are typical amongst certain devices. When working with terminals on Mac and Linux, you will often see tty used to represent a communication port rather than 'COM port'.Data, Stop, and Parity Bits - Each packet of data sent to and from the terminal has a specific format. These were the electromechanical typewriters used to enter information to the terminal and, thus, to the mainframe. Much like terminal is synonymous with the terminals of old, so too is teletype. Once a device has a port assigned to it, that port will be used every time that device is plugged into the computer.Your device will show up on your computer as either COM# (if you’re on a Windows machine) or /dev/tty.usbserial-# (if you’re on a Mac/Linux computer), where the #’s are unique numbers or alphabetic characters.TTY - TTY stands for teletypewriter or teletype. ![]() ![]() Be aware, though, that sometimes local echo can come back to bite you. The benefit from this is being able to see if you are in fact typing the correct commands should you encounter errors. This setting simply tells the terminal to print everything you type. If a string of 5 characters needs to be sent to the micro, you may need a string that can actually hold 7 characters on account of the 10 and 13 sent after every command.Local Echo - Local echo is a setting that can be changed in either the serial terminal or the device to which you are talking, and sometimes both. More importantly, when working with microcontrollers, be aware of how you are sending data. With this profile enabled, you can connect to a Bluetooth module through a serial terminal. Just be aware that this can be an issue.Serial Port Profile (SPP) - The Serial Port Profile is a Bluetooth profile that allows for serial communication between a Bluetooth device and a host/slave device. Most devices can handle commands with or without local echo. For example, if you type hello with local echo on, the receiving device might see hheelllloo, which is likely not the correct command.
0 Comments
Leave a Reply. |
AuthorJennifer ArchivesCategories |